Technical Operations at the Haarlem site is responsible for technology transfer of new products into the site , component support , and execution of c ap ital p rojects to install or upgrade packaging line capabilities aligned with new product needs.

Purpose of the position

As the Technology Transfer Lead, you will be at the forefront of ensuring our site is technically ready for new product introductions and technology transfers. Your role will involve managing all aspects of transferring both new and existing products and processes, with a strong emphasis on delivering results on time and maintaining clear visibility into device assembly and packaging operations. You will work hand-in-hand with Development and Commercialization teams to shape and implement our technology transfer strategy, acting as the key point of contact for all related activities. In this position, you will also develop and manage an integrated project plan, ensuring that we are fully prepared for product introductions and technology transfers, while effectively communicating any technical risks and progress updates to your colleagues and stakeholders. Your leadership and collaboration will be vital in driving our success in this critical area.

Main responsibilities

  • Leverage subject matter expertise in packaging and combination products, including process, device assembly, packaging, equipment, and components, to rigorously assess site readiness through proactive risk evaluations of technical and execution risks.

  • Identify risks across functional areas and interfaces, developing robust mitigation strategies.

  • Operate effectively in ambiguous situations, supporting scenario planning and options analysis to facilitate risk-based decision-making.

  • Utilize demonstrated technical breadth in end-to-end assembly and packaging operations to lead a technical team focused on achieving rigorous outcomes, including process qualification and validation, component qualification, and specifications.

  • Collaborate with the site team to develop and set strategies for tech transfer and new product introduction.

  • Schedule and facilitate technical reviews related to technology transfer.

  • Be accountable for conducting After Action Reviews and sharing knowledge with other technology transfer teams.

  • Ensure compliance with company global and regulatory requirements, executing current Good Manufacturing Practices (cGMP) in all daily activities and job functions.

  • Work collaboratively to foster a safe and compliant culture.

  • Build strong cross-divisional partnerships with site leaders, functional management, and stakeholders from Research & Development, Commercialization, Technical Operations, Operations, Quality, Analytical Regulatory-CMC, and Supply Chain.

Your profile

  • A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Engineering or a related field, with 5–7+ years of experience in device assembly and/or packaging, and project leadership.

  • T echnical expertise in packaging technologies (vials, syringes, autoinjectors, etc.) and facility/equipment readiness.

  • Has expertise in the pharmaceutical, biotechnology, medical device, food (medical), or chemical industries.

  • Proven success in leading cross-functional teams and managing complex projects .

  • Strong understanding of cGMP, regulatory requirements, and change control processes.

  • Excellent communication and stakeholder engagement skills.

  • A proactive, flexible mindset with a passion for solving problems and driving results.
